SIZED FOR LOOPS NOT JAGS!
If you are like me and only looked at the caliber these patches were made for and incorrectly assumed they worked with a jag of that caliber then you are going to be disappointed. I am leaving 5 stars because of the quality of the fabric and when I cut them to size for a jag they work splendidly. However I do think that Sinclair needs to put a disclaimer on the description of this that these are not the appropriate size patch to be used with a jag. This is an enormous number of patches to have to cut with scissors to work and is a huge waste of time. Again, when either coupled with a loop as people mentioned in the reviews, or cut to size for a jag they work well.

.223 Mil Spec Patches
I have used these for years in and out of the military in all situations. They have fabric texture on one side and soft on the other, by design. They have always frayed at the ends, easy to dispose of, no big deal. Correct size for .223 that I have always used is 1.25 inches, never had a problem in any ARs with these. THE RIGHT EQUIPMENT
In my years in the military and cleaning everything from M1 Garands, M14 to M16 I never used a jag to clean my equiptment, always used the loop. The loop was standard equipment issue. So if these are GI "issue" it stand to reason that they are for the loop only. Hey, you are getting twice the patches for the money when you cut them up. Happy safe shooting.
